At its core, the 180-Ah battery is a deep cycle battery designed to provide a steady flow of energy over an extended period. This is in contrast to starter batteries, which are meant to provide a burst of energy to start an engine. The 180-Ah battery’s unique characteristics make it an ideal choice for a wide range of applications, from camping and RVing to commercial and industrial uses. With its impressive capacity to store and deliver energy, this battery has become a go-to solution for those seeking reliable and efficient power.

FAQs

1. What applications are ideal for an 180ah Battery?

An 180ah Battery is ideal for applications requiring high capacity and reliable power, such as RVs, boats, solar energy systems, and backup power supplies.

2. How do I properly charge a 180-Ah battery to maximize its lifespan?

Use a charger compatible with the battery type, follow the manufacturer’s charging guidelines, avoid overcharging, and ensure the battery is charged at recommended voltage levels.

3. Can I use a 180-Ah battery with my existing solar power system?

Yes, a 180-Ah battery can be integrated into most solar power systems, but ensure that the system’s voltage and controller are compatible with the battery specifications.

4. What maintenance is required to keep a 180-Ah battery performing optimally?

Regularly check and clean the battery terminals, ensure proper connections, avoid deep discharges, and store the battery in a cool, dry place when not in use.

5. How can I extend the lifespan of my 180-Ah battery?

Avoid deep discharges, charge the battery properly, keep it at a moderate temperature, and perform regular maintenance checks.

6. What is the typical lifespan of a 180-Ah battery?

The lifespan varies based on usage and maintenance but typically ranges from 5 to 10 years for high-quality batteries.
